_________________ FACT SHEET FACT SHEET India Key Facts India - Country Profile 10 the largest economy in the world. 4th in terms of PPP. Will overtake Japan in PPP terms by 2010, to be the 3rd largest Average annual growth rates (1995-2005) GDP : 6.5% per annum Services : 7.8% per annum Industry : 6.6% per annum Competitive manufacturing sector with a low cost base, huge skill set and a “can do” attitude India is making an impact as an exporter especially in garments, footwear, auto components, engineering goods and software.

Challenges of Sourcing Challenge in determining the right sourcing strategy Challenge in evaluating and training foreign suppliers Challenge in maintaining consistent quality Challenge in maintaining sourcing infrastructure in foreign country Challenge in facing infrastructure and bureaucratic bottlenecks
9
Challenges In India Business Issues Lack of awareness to Western Business Environment (Mismatch of expectations, working on different standards ) Transactional rather than Relationship approach (Focus on short term gains, quick profits and lack of consistency) Ambiguous Communication (Not all cards on table, over reliance on verbal communication) Things happen when they happen (Bureaucracy, paperwork, infrastructure and corruption)
10
Challenges In India Cultural Issues “No problem” approach (What you want to hear rather than what you should hear) “Chalta Hai” – It will do (Scant attention to detail) Indian Stretchable Time (Missed timelines, disruption to schedules) ASAP approach – Unplanned Action (Fail to prepare and Prepare to fail)

Our focus on ACTUAL TOTAL COST Whether buying or selling, price is only a part of the actual total cost. Costs of quality including consistency, maintenance, disposal, and environmental factors, and costs of the transaction including buying resources, effort, time, payment terms, and renegotiations must be considered when assessing or comparing actual total cost of propositions, products or services. transaction cost of acquisition including buying resources, effort, time, and payment terms value cost of quality including consistency maintenance, disposal, and environmental costs price basic cost of product or service
